Good morning!  
What is on the list you mentally keep of "things that will make you happy?" I used to have a long list. I needed some more "me" time, I needed more one-on-one time with my daughter or spouse or friends. I needed more money or less debt. Interestingly, one of things that I have found that is most helpful in creating happiness right here and now is to throw out your list of "what I need to be happy."
 
Happiness isn't gained when we achieve something. When we achieve something we gain only that which we were trying to achieve. Happiness is created, moment-to-moment by choice. It isn't waiting anywhere for us, it is already here.
